Cancelling a listing
I committed to sell my laptop to a buyer several days ago. Nothing has happened since and the buyer does not respond to my inquiries. I have another buyer who wants it and I'd like to cancel the listing, but can't.

·3 years agoThe buyer has 4 days to pay. On the fifth day, cancel the sale for non-payment.

After it has been canceled, relist and give the other buyer the new item number.

·3 years agoThe website will allow you to cancel at any time. However, you will want to wait for the four FULL days to expire (4x24 hours from the time of accepting the offer). That's why we recommend cancelling on the fifth day due to buyer non-payment. Otherwise, if you cancel to soon, you, as the seller, will receive a defect for not fulfilling your obligation. I suspect the non-payment option will not appear if you elect to cancel too soon.
